I’m eloping in 10 days. I booked an app to get my hair and makeup done, as we will have a photographer with us at the ceremony. When I made the app they didn’t ask me if I wanted to a trial, probably because I am eloping. I am getting both done in their salon, then traveling 30 mins from there to the ceremony location (outdoors). I don’t wear much makeup normally, usually primer, light foundation (BB cream), and brown gel. Rarely do I wear eye makeup because I have sensitive eyes. I definitely want a dewy, natural look. I’m not sure about false lashes, I have never worn them before. My skin tends to be dry, but oily in t-zone, and I have large pores. What can I expect for my makeup app? Should I bring pictures of makeup examples I like? What should I do to prep my skin?

    Definitely bring pictures of what you want! They should ask you about your skin type and any concerns you have also. I also suggest that since you don't typically wear makeup, that perhaps you should ask for them to go a bit more on the natural side. Usually wedding makeup is done a bit more “dramatic” and bold looking because it translates much lighter looking in pictures. If you don't mind it for pictures, just prepare yourself that you may look a little different than you're used to. Ive heard of so many women crying and hating their makeup from their trials because they think they look terrible or like a clown, and it seems like it was mostly those who don't really wear makeup, if any at all. Try to have an open mind and relax and enjoy the experience. But definitely see if you can find any reviews or pictures of their work to make sure they can do what you want! Best of luck!
